Dewnania, officially the Republic of Dewnania (Terghyntek: Repoblek Dewnanieth) is an island nation in Northern Aurora, located in the Filari Sea between Kaltariezh, Biramura and Oscrelia. It is the region's most densely populated country. Its capital and largest city is Synta Berlewen, which is home to about 71% of the country's roughly 5.63 million residents. Over an area of 1,573 km² (607 sq mi), Dewnania is the worlds fifth smallest and second most densely populated country, and second in Aurora behind Blueacia despite land reclaimation projects increasing its size by approximately 16% since the 1970s. The official and national language is Terghyntek.

Dewnania has been inhabited since before the Great Vanishing, with limited records pointing to cava civilisation as old as 3000 BCE. Known as Dewnan, its location as the sole island in the western Filari Sea has historically given it a great strategic importance as both an emporium and naval base, with a succession of powers having contested and ruled the islands, including the Kaltariz, Salovians, Morstaybishlians, Ethalrians, and later Terghintians. Its contemporary era began in 1703, when it formed apart of the wider Kingdom of Terghintia whom gained independence from the Grand Matriarchy of Ethalria in the Ethalrian Succession War. Terghintia prospered as a minor colonial empire. During the Great War, the Gwlas, a socialist movement and later political party led to the overthrow of the absolute monarchy and establishment of a socialist state. Loosing the Marisva region in the Great War and suffering severe territorial losses in the Auroran Imperial War to Ethalria, the Dergyntow government fled to the island of Dewnan in 1971. When Ethalria surrendered in 1975, Morstaybishlia did not hand back their mainland despite two appeals to the International Forum in 1975 and 1981. The Terghyntow government officially established Dewnanieth as its successor state in 1975, and since then has been relatively skeptical of Morstaybishlia and Ethalria; the ACA and its successor organisation the UNAC. Dewnania applied to join the UNAC in 2018 following the Auroran-Cerenerian War, but was denied on democratic grounds. It since applied to join as an observer state in 2024.

An industrialised exporter of natural resources such as copper, gold, oil, fish and wood in the second half of the 19th century. Terghintow chemist Jago Marghek discovered Dewnanium in 1886 and named it after the nations' island. Ironically, Dewnania has been the world's largest exporter of Dewnanium products since mass extraction from placer monazite deposits began in the 1950s; including Dewnanium acetate, cryocoolers, Dewnanium magnets, glass, lasers, et cetera.

Terghintia introduced labour-market and social reforms in the mid 20th century which formed the basis for the present Dewnanian welfare state model and advanced mixed economy. With its growth based on economic globalisation and international trade, it has integrated itself within the world economy, successfully reconciling economic efficiency with social equality. Dewnania has a relatively high GDP per capita of 53,996 KRB compared to the rest of Aurora.

Dewnania is a unitary semi-presidential republic. Its legal system is based on civil law. Gwlas has led Dewnania and Terghintia in all but eight years since 1911, the last time it was out of government was in 1956. While it supports and practices free election and multi-party democracy, Gwlas employs notable dominance over society and politics. They currently hold 101 out of 124 elected seats in the Senedh. Multi-speciesism and multi-culturalism is enshrined in the constitution.

Name and etymology

The Staynish name Dewnania is a staynification of the native Terghyntek cognate word for the island, Dewnan, thought to mean 'deep valley dwellers' from Proto-Uspric *dubnos meaning 'deep'. It likely refers to the dry valley which spawned the base for its civilisation.

History

Prehistory to Terghyntow Settlement

Prehistory

Present-day Dewnania has been inhabited since prehistoric times. The earliest confirmed site of anatomically modern cava activity on Dewnania is Nanke, situated on the western coast, indicating that hunter-gatherers were active on the island from over half a million years ago. Cava skulls were found buried with circular copper pendants, radiocarbon dated to approximately 26,500 BCE, indicating the earliest use of copper extraction anywhere in the world.

The discovery of the Kothyndanna underground city below present day Nanclemma has structures that are dated as old as 6,500 BCE. The youngest structures correlate with the abandonment of the city in the Great Vanishing around 1,800 to 1,700 BCE. Mass burials discovered around this time indicate that the cava civilisation may have been wiped out by a plague; this plague may have wiped out the wider cava civilisation of Aurora leading to societal collapse in the mixed cava-elf civilisations.
